Transaction 523e1f85c2a6d6b03a924c7b7c42b3abcc1d0665bb5453367615c82213e43360

24 Input
1 Outputs
  • 523e1f85c2a6d6b03a924c7b7c42b3abcc1d0665bb5453367615c82213e43360:0
  • value  1376163
    address  3C2KsC3o2pDitKSe2UDYmC3K81kdj4ozHc